The Renaissance of Pipelines and Our Sell Discipline – Ep 113
https://traffic.libsyn.com/secure/intellectualinvestor/The_Renaissance_of_Pipelines_and_Our_Sell_Discipline_v2_2021-02-22.mp3
At first, investors loved them. Then, they hated them. Now, investors have left them for dead. Oil and gas pipeline companies are anything but popular. But they are essential businesses, with rising free cash flow and substantial dividend yields. In this podcast, Vitaliy walks you through IMA’s recent investment in oil pipelines, and then gives an overview of his firm’s sell discipline.

Value & Growth Demagogues – Ep 110
https://traffic.libsyn.com/secure/intellectualinvestor/Value__Growth_Demagogues_v1_2021-01-30.mp3
Vitaliy has a problem with both value- and growth investing demagogues. While value demagogues tend to believe any company that trades at a P/E above the market average is too frothy, growth demagogues claim that price doesn’t matter. In this podcast, Vitaliy explains how both camps can be too narrow minded, and how investors should learn from the best of both sides when selecting companies to buy.
